What gets reverse engineered
Legacy machine parts with no drawing on file, worn components that need a replacement made, competitor products being evaluated for redesign, and one-off physical prototypes that were never modeled. If a part exists but no usable CAD file does, it's a reverse engineering job.
How it works
1. Send what you have
Calipers and key measurements, a 3D scan (STL/OBJ/point cloud), or clear photos with a known reference dimension. No existing CAD file is required to start.
2. Model rebuild
The part is rebuilt as a parametric SolidWorks model — not a dumb mesh trace. Fits, symmetry, and manufacturing features are inferred from the geometry so the result behaves like an original design, not a scan copy.
3. Delivery
Native SolidWorks (SLDPRT/SLDASM), neutral STEP/IGES for any CAD system, and a dimensioned PDF drawing on request — all yours, no license lock-in.

Do I need a 3D scanner to start?
No. A 3D scan speeds up complex freeform surfaces, but most mechanical parts can be reverse engineered from manual measurements and photos alone.
